Menu

[r882]: / trunk / php-java-bridge / server / buildLauncherWindows.sh  Maximize  Restore  History

Download this file

30 lines (26 with data), 1.5 kB

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#!/bin/sh
echo "package php.java.bridge;" >php/java/bridge/LauncherWindows.java
echo 'public class LauncherWindows {' >>php/java/bridge/LauncherWindows.java
echo 'public static final byte[] bytes = new byte[]{' >>php/java/bridge/LauncherWindows.java
cat $* | od -vb | sed 's/^[0-7]*//;s/^[^ ]* //;s/[0-7][0-7]*/(byte)0&,/g' | split -l600
cat xaa >>php/java/bridge/LauncherWindows.java
rm xaa
echo '};}' >>php/java/bridge/LauncherWindows.java
echo "package php.java.bridge;" >php/java/bridge/LauncherWindows2.java
echo 'public class LauncherWindows2 {' >>php/java/bridge/LauncherWindows2.java
echo 'public static final byte[] bytes = new byte[]{' >>php/java/bridge/LauncherWindows2.java
cat xab >>php/java/bridge/LauncherWindows2.java
rm xab
echo '};}' >>php/java/bridge/LauncherWindows2.java
echo "package php.java.bridge;" >php/java/bridge/LauncherWindows3.java
echo 'public class LauncherWindows3 {' >>php/java/bridge/LauncherWindows3.java
echo 'public static final byte[] bytes = new byte[]{' >>php/java/bridge/LauncherWindows3.java
cat xac >>php/java/bridge/LauncherWindows3.java
rm xac
echo '};}' >>php/java/bridge/LauncherWindows3.java
echo "package php.java.bridge;" >php/java/bridge/LauncherWindows4.java
echo 'public class LauncherWindows4 {' >>php/java/bridge/LauncherWindows4.java
echo 'public static final byte[] bytes = new byte[]{' >>php/java/bridge/LauncherWindows4.java
cat xad >>php/java/bridge/LauncherWindows4.java
rm xad
echo '};}' >>php/java/bridge/LauncherWindows4.java